The Hind Rajab Foundation has taken a significant step by filing a criminal complaint in a Chilean court, targeting an Israeli national of Ukrainian descent who serves as a former sniper. This legal action underlines the urgency surrounding the complex issues related to the violent conflict in Gaza, particularly emphasizing the impact of military operations on civilian lives. Lucia Newman, a journalist known for her comprehensive coverage of Middle Eastern issues, is investigating the alleged role of this individual in contributing to fatalities in the region.

This initiative by the Hind Rajab Foundation is reflective of a broader movement within international civil society aimed at seeking accountability for actions deemed to be violations of human rights.
